Posteromedial vertical capsulotomy selectively increases the extension gap in posterior stabilized total knee arthroplasty

ConclusionIn PS-type TKA, it is possible to obtain selective expansion of about 2.7  mm of the extension gap by PMVC. Therefore, gap balance can be acquired by soft-tissue treatment while preserving the bone. The PMVC was a useful method for acquiring gap balance and preserving the bone stock.Level of evidenceIV.
